Mike Jones, Simon & Schuster’s publishing director for non-fiction, has resigned from the company and will leave this week.
Jones joined S&S UK from Bloomsbury six years ago and has published an impressive list, including names such as Gordon Brown, Iain Martin, Andrew Wilson, James Barr, David Reynolds, Ferdinand Mount and Monty Don.
As part of a brief statement give to The Bookseller, the company said: “Mike has also published bestselling memoirs by the likes of Dannii Minogue, Brian Moore, Peter Hook, Arnold Schwarzenegger and Ranulph Fiennes.”
Jones told The Bookseller: "I shall be sad to leave some very good friends and valued colleagues behind, and some brilliant authors and their fantastic books. I'm going to do some structural editing work and consultancy on a freelance basis over the summer. After 20 years in publishing I am also looking forward to spending a little more time with my young family."
